Sometimes you have to pinch yourself that what you’re looking at is actually real and that was certainly the case with this sunrise that I photographed at Broughton Creek near Berry. There was absolutely no wind and Broughton Creek is a very slow moving river anyway, so the backlit high cloud was perfectly reflected in the still waters.
I took this photograph in the winter of 2018, using my wide angle 10-22mm lens at its longest 22mm focal range.
